4. Revlon Hair Dryer Brush: Yes, you’ve probably heard about this and wondered if it really works. The answer is yet. Although I will offer you some words of caution: despite what it says it can do, do NOT use this to dry your hair from soaking wet. Over time, you will fry it. Use a hairdryer to rough-dry your hair, put on some heat protectant, and then use it.
